Teletype is a company located in MA, they produce lots of diffrent GPS devices and accessories, their GPS Map data now support US, Canada, Euro and Global, however, I didn't choose their software bundle, since their interface is too simple/plain to me, plus a littlbe bit expensive. Anyway, this article will introduce their newest GPS BT receiver, please see the first picture:
1. In the package includes BT GPS receiver, charging cradle, carry case, one magnetic pad, one cigratte charger. the receiver is made in Korea
2. BT receiver, one BT connection LED, one Satellite signal LED and one battery LED
3. Receiver left side, one external antenna jack, one DC in jack
4. Receiver right side, power switch, you also can see two charge connectors on the bottom
5. Receiver back side
6. Open the battery door, three rechargable AAA battery
7. The batter door attached one mental for the magnetic pad attach.
